Microzed won't power up on FMC carrier

e14 Contributor
e14 Contributor over 11 years ago

I have been using a Rev F Microzed for some weeks with great success. Today i connected the board to a Avnet FMC carrier. I followed the instructions in the getting started guide but when I applied power to the carrier the MicroZed refuses to power up, the microzed power good led is however on. If i remove the microzed from the carrier all is well again. Does anyone know what the problem might be.

    Can you be more specific in what you mean by "refuses to power up" as you mention the MicroZed power good LED is on.

     

    If you are trying to configure the MicroZed from the JTAG connector you will need to move your JTAG adapter to the connector on the FMC Carrier Card as the one on the MicroZed will not work when plugged into a carrier card. If you are looking for an output on the USB-UART connection to your terminal program you might try a reset in case you missed the initial output as you are not using this to power the board now.

    Let me clarify. The mmicrozed is set to boot from SD, when it's off the carrier, Linux boots and operates just fine. I see the normal output on the USB terminal. When I attach the card to the carrier the microzed no longer boots. I do see the good power led on the microzed, but the Zynq seems ( not sure ) to remain in reset. The blue led on the microzed no longer lights. Also there are no LEDs lit on the carrier. My hardware design in the Zynq contains only the Zynq, nothing else. Do I need to configure the Design in any particular way for use with the carrier? Also, there is mention of an example design in the getting started guide, but I can only find an example for the io card.

    Turns out my Microzed is in some way faulty. I replaced it by a new one and all is well
